Position: TKIE - Sr. Analyzer Technician (Texas City, TX)
Overview

Summary/ Objective

The position of an Analyzer Technician III is responsible to calibrate, repair and maintain analyzers. An Analyzer Technician will perform work as required to maximize the quality of the Company while maintaining the specified expectations of the client and ensure safe working environment while performing work and will conduct all Company business in accordance with Company policies and procedures. This position will maintain professionalism throughout all business dealings, both internally and externally.

Responsibilities

Essential Functions

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Calibrate, repair, and maintain analyzers.
  • Read and work from related blueprints.
  • Cut, bend, and install tubing related to instruments.
  • May test controls to regulate factors such as current flow, timing cycle, pressure, temperature, or vacuum, according to specifications.
  • May disassemble instrument or device to determine cause of defective operation.
  • May read quality control manuals and testing specifications to obtain data to test or calibrate specific devices.
  • Teach/mentor others.
  • Ensure all work is performed in accordance with applicable environmental, health, safety and building codes as required by federal, state, local and refinery regulations.
  • Maintain poise and focus under time constraint and adverse conditions.
  • Attend and complete trainings as required by the Company and client.
  • Pass all required drug/alcohol testing and background requirements.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
  • Knowledgeable, trained and proven in all aspects of process Analytical systems maintenance. Able to efficiently diagnose and repair difficult problems associated with the following:
    • Chromatography (gas and liquid phase)
      • Column switching techniques
      • Multi-column techniques
      • Multi-detector techniques
    • Spectroscopy
      • Infrared
      • Ultraviolet
      • Near Infrared
      • Laser, e.g. Tunable Diode Laser
    • Oxygen Measurment
      • Paramagnetic
      • Electrochemical
    • Moisture Measurment
      • Hygrometry
      • Solid State Sensors
      • Aluminum Oxide Sensors
    • Titrators & associated methods
    • pH & Conductivity measurment
    • Total Organic Carbon
    • Continuous Emission Monitor Systems
      • Rosemount
      • ABB
      • HRVOC (Highly Reactive Volatile Organic Compounds)
    • Sampling Techniques
    • Serial Communications
  • Optimization of analytical systems ( improve accuracy, repeatability, reliability )
  • Provide input regarding the development & engineering of new analyzer systems.
  • Assist and train less skilled Analyzer Technicians
  • Basic chemistry

    Work Environment

    This job operates in a petrochechemical / refinery environment. Exposure to cold working conditions during winter months and hot working conditions during the summer months; exposure to noise, workers must wear protecting hearing equipment or frequently shout in order to be heard above ambient noise level. In an emergency situation, exposure to hazardous chemicals may occur and the use of a respirator is required.

    All employees are required to be fit tested for the various respirators used as well as the ability to successfully pass a pulmonary function test (PFT).

    Physical Demands

    The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.

    While performing the duties of the job, the position of an Analyzer Technician III may be extremely physical le perform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required, and for long periods of time to bend, stoop, walk, climb, squat, reach, kneel, push/pull, stand, sit, hand strength and dexterity. An Analyzer Technician III will frequently lift up to 25 pounds and occasionally lift more than 50 pounds.

    Must be able to work in confined spaces. Must be able to work at heights and be able to climb ladders and stairways and work off platforms.
